Hybrid vehicles offer a number of benefits over traditional gasoline-powered vehicles, including improved fuel efficiency, lower emissions, and reduced operating costs. Hybrids combine a gasoline engine with an electric motor and battery pack, which allows them to switch between gasoline and electric power depending on driving conditions. This results in significant fuel savings, especially in stop-and-go traffic or when driving at low speeds.

Question 5: How do hybrid vehicles reduce emissions?
Hybrid vehicles reduce emissions by combining a gasoline engine with an electric motor and battery pack. This allows them to switch between gasoline and electric power depending on driving conditions, resulting in lower tailpipe emissions and reduced greenhouse gas emissions.
